It's now possible to tab to "display settings" and "input settings"
and access them with enter or space. Also escape can now be used
to close the settings screen.
The ULS trigger in interlanguage position is a button to get
native accessibility features.
Also removed `mw.hook( 'mw.uls.settings.open' ).fire( 'uls' );` as
it didn't seem very useful and there wasn't immediately obvious
place to put it. The existing click handler could be removed because
the settings dialog themselves place event listeners.
The patch is a bit longer than strictly necessary because the CSS
was mess (rules in different modules, poorly organized) and I had
to bring related rules together to understand them.

when appearing on right side of screen
Languageselect was mostly fixed in 354378, but I forgot the
settings ones, so the triangle just disappears when
switching dialogs currently. This follows up on that and
properly fixes it.
Sidebar callouts now appear toward content regardless of
where they're appearing from, or the language
directionality. Triangles are now consistently alligned to
the top of the callout (same position in languageselect and
compact language links) to avoid issues with it appearing
over a scrollbar.
Sideways callout triangles (carets) are consolidated into a
single rendering approach and mixin across compact language
links and toolbox language selector.

For interlanguage toggle, interlanguage position is no longer assumed to be a
left sidebar, and is determined on the fly in order to appear correctly
regardless of where it is, and not go off the side of the page. This works
across most skins, and regardless of language directionality.
Does not necessarily resolve issues with interlanguage links appearing in the
middle of the page (header/footer), or the callout just plain not fitting for
other reasons (mobile devices).

Without this isolation the input method name can be shown
incorrectly when its direction is different from the direction
of the "How to use" element.
This only breaks on Firefox; Chrome somehow shows it correctly
without isolation, but isolation makes sense in any case.
